Sats/Research/Building/etc take longer to complete
  • Effect: a sat is ordered with 20-21 days left until the end of the month report. But during the last days it will be delayed and the sat will only be completed after the month ends.
  • Cause: according to one poster on the 2K forums this bug also applies to the missions created by the AI at the beginning of the month. It seems that the game discounts the time spend while "Scanning For Activity" in Building Projects/Research/etc completion time but ignores the time spend in Mission Control without advancing the clock. This includes Skyranger flight time but also when you are simply looking at the Hologlobe and waiting the hours for a soldier to recover from an injury or for a critical research project to be completed.
  • Implications: to avoid this bug, either start projects a few days earlier than their completed date. Or don't wait on Mission Control for the clock to tick down and always hit "Scan For Activity" or launch the Skyranger, even if that means you won't have that soldier who is recovering for an injury available for the mission.
  • Status: Reported on the 2K forums.

Aliens teleporting
  • Effect: Alien squads (unprovoked) are not actually moving around the map, but teleporting short distances, which can be witnessed with use of battle scanner, for example. Side effects include enemy squads appearing right on top of your troops, or inside a ring of soldiers. Also, you may notice on terror missions a civilian dying, while next turn you find last enemy squad on the map - a squad of 2 drones and a sectopod far away from that point. Also, sometimes, rarely though, even "provoked" aliens suddenly teleport on top of your troops.
  • Cause: Aside from obvious lazy programming on developer's side, no discernible ways to reproduce the bug - seems to be totally random (can happen only with mobile squads, of course)
  • Status: Reported on XCOM 2K forum master bug thread, with saves attached. Nearly fixed on EW although it can still happen.

Snipers can switch weapons after moving and hitting Overwatch

  • Effect: if a Sniper goes to Overwatch with his pistol it's possible to left click on the soldier and switch the weapon back to the Sniper Rifle. This allows for Move and Overwatch if the Sniper doesn't have the Snap Shot ability.
  • Cause: Related to how soldiers can open doors, disable power nodes, etc. even after all of its moves are spent.
  • Fix? Was this fixed in EW after Power Node and Door Opening was disabled for a soldier who has used all of his moves?
  • No, can still do it, so apparently unrelated.

"Free" Overwatch doesn't check ammo.

  • Effect: A soldier taking an overwatch shot when not on overwatch or suppression(likely due to Assault Close Combat Specialist perk) can make unlimited shots regardless of remaining ammo count.
  • Cause: Likely caused by programming oversight; the game probably checks whether you have enough ammo for overwatch when you GO on Overwatch, not when you make the shot.
  • Question: Do low-ammo Setinel Supports also trigger this?

Second Foundry pistol upgrade doesn't function

  • Effect: Although it offers +10% to aim, and appears under the heading "Pistol" on the shot info screen, Improved Pistol II is never actually added on to your final chance to hit.
  • Cause: Programming oversight. No sequence of user actions can cause or avoid this; it occurs in all situations.
  • Fixed in EW.

Difficulty Change & Weapon Drop

  • Effect: If during a mission on normal or harder difficulties, an alien is given more damage than it has HP on easier difficulties, and the difficulty is turned down, the alien simply dies with it's intact weapon. Best demonstrated with Sectoids & grenades: ie, switching to Impossible, which gives it 4 HP, grenading it for 3 damage, and switching to any other difficulty. It will die, and a Plasma Pistol will show up in the post-mission Artifact Recovery list.
  • Cause: Programming oversight?

Overwatch not triggering bug

  • Effect: Alien finishing its movement in one of the 8 squares surrounding a soldier will not trigger overwatch fire if the alien was not previously visible to that unit. Alien will then proceed to murder your unit. To avoid, you have to remember not to place an overwatching soldier within one tile of a space that an alien can appear in. Such as corners. Common occurrences are rooftops with Chryssalids jumping up and overwatch not triggering, unit proceeds to get melee attacked. Also when positioning a soldier by a UFO opening and then waking up aliens inside from another angle.
  • Cause: Programming oversight or intentional difficulty increase.

Kinetic Strike Module and Flamethrower Upgrades

  • Effect: Value after 50% upgrade from a previous game is carried over to the next to result. KSM: 12 Base Damage is the normal amount with 18 after upgrade the first time, in the next game the upgrade will give you 27 damage points. Flamethrower: 6 Base Damage before upgrade, 9 after, subsequent campaigns upgrade to 13.
  • Cause:Unknown
  • Solution: if MECs go unused in your next campaign, the bug will clear. After 1 game at bugged damage points it reset themselves to basic value.

Deep Pockets & Combat Stims

  • Effect: Deep Pockets increases number of use for items by +1. Combat Stims is not affected, despite being an usable item (however, it is viewed as a skill during tactical game).
  • Cause: May be related to "skill" representation, developer overlook or intentional game design.

Disabling Shot vs Overwatch Aliens

  • Effect: Weapon is disabled on the alien's next turn as per usual, but the alien can take an unlimited number of reaction shots during the player's turn. After discovering the bug (3 HP sectoid fired 5 reaction shots in a single turn at 3 different targets) was able to duplicate it on at least two other occasions.
  • Cause: An alien ends its turn on overwatch. On your turn, you use a sniper to disable the alien's weapon... either to close the distance to kill it or to stun it.
  • Status: Reported on XCOM 2k forum master bug thread. Supposedly fixed on EW but there are still reports coming of this bug.
